James Cadle

July 24, 1930 — May 15, 2009

Mr. James William Cadle age 78, of Lakeland Dr Coosa Community Rome, GA, died Friday, May 15, 2009, at a local hospital.



Mr. Cadle was born in Floyd County, GA. on July 24, 1930, the son of the late Walter Ray and Elsie Ramsey Cadle. He served in the United States Army during the Koran Conflict Mr. Cadle lived 10 years in the Cedartown GA. and 20 years in Juliet Georgia and the rest of his life in Rome GA. He was retried form Georgia Power Company after 42 years of service. He attended the Rolling Hills Baptist Church in Cedartown Georgia. Mr. Cadle was a Worshipful Master of the Masonic Lodge and He was also a Shiner in Forthsyth County GA. He was preceded in death by is beloved wife Mrs. Betty Jo Cadle on November 08, 2005 and his brother Sonny Cadle.



Survivors include one son; Norman Pace of Coosa; one daughter Sandra Pace of Coosa.; one brother and sister-in-law Paul and Brenda Cadle of Rome, ;two sisters and brother-in-laws Charette and John Britt and Betty and William Wiggly all of Rome ; Four grandchildren Rodney Patrick Cadle, Laura Jan Pace Brownlow and her husband Jaymie, Danny William Cadle and B.J. Pace all of Rome,; eight great- grandchildren also survive.
